Nancy Pelosi visits Dalai Lama in northern India amid rising US-China tensions

Former U.S. House Speaker Nancy Pelosi has arrived in northern India’s Himachal Pradesh for a significant meeting with the Dalai Lama, highlighting her ongoing support for Tibet.

The incident took place at Kangra Airport on June 18.

Visuals showed the U.S. delegation, including Nancy Pelosi, arrived at the airport, where officials from the Central Tibetan Administration warmly received them. The officials greeted the delegation with friendly handshakes and respectful “namaste” gestures, creating a scene of cordial and heartfelt welcome.

Nancy Pelosi, the former Speaker of the US House of Representatives, has arrived in Himachal Pradesh at Kangra airport. She is scheduled to meet with the Dalai Lama, the exiled Tibetan spiritual leader, in Dharamshala.

Pelosi is part of a prominent six-member delegation from the US that includes Gregory W. Meeks, Jim McGovern, Ami Bera, Mariannette Miller-Meeks, and Nicole Malliotakis.

Upon disembarking, Pelosi expressed her enthusiasm: “It is very exciting to be here.”

This visit comes just before the Dalai Lama’s planned medical trip to the US for knee treatment. The nature of his engagements in the US remains uncertain.
